Why Choose Eco-Friendly Charters?

Traditional boating activities can have a significant environmental impact, from fuel emissions to wildlife disturbances. By opting for eco-friendly charter options, you can minimize your ecological footprint while still enjoying the rich marine life and stunning landscapes that California has to offer. These charters often use cleaner energy sources and implement sustainable practices to protect the ocean environment.

Eco-friendly charters not only benefit the environment but also enhance your experience on the water. Many operators provide educational resources about marine ecosystems and conservation efforts, making your trip both enjoyable and informative.

Types of Eco-Friendly Vessels

When considering an eco-friendly charter, it’s important to understand the different types of vessels available. Here are some popular options:

  • Electric Boats: Powered by electricity, these boats produce zero emissions and operate quietly, allowing you to enjoy the serenity of the ocean.
  • Solar-Powered Boats: Harnessing the sun's energy, these vessels are perfect for sunny California days, offering a sustainable way to explore coastal waters.
  • Sailboats: With minimal reliance on engines, sailboats offer a classic and environmentally conscious way to navigate the sea.

Top Destinations for Eco-Friendly Charters

California is home to numerous stunning locations that cater to eco-friendly boating. Some top destinations include:

  1. Channel Islands National Park: Known as the "Galapagos of North America," this park offers unique wildlife and pristine waters ideal for eco-conscious charters.
  2. Monterey Bay: Famous for its rich biodiversity, this bay provides opportunities for whale watching and exploring marine sanctuaries.
  3. San Francisco Bay: Explore the iconic sights of San Francisco from the water while adhering to sustainable practices.

Tips for a Sustainable Charter Experience

To ensure your boating adventure is as eco-friendly as possible, consider these tips:

  • Choose reputable charter companies that prioritize sustainability and have eco-certifications.
  • Minimize waste by bringing reusable containers and avoiding single-use plastics.
  • Respect marine life by maintaining a safe distance from wildlife and adhering to all local regulations.
